GRM Overseas Limited is a prominent player in the Indian rice industry, specializing in the milling, processing, and marketing of basmati rice. Their operations encompass both branded and non-branded products, catering to a diverse range of consumers. The company's long history, beginning in 1974, has allowed them to establish a strong presence within the domestic market and cultivate significant export capabilities.
A key aspect of GRM Overseas' business model is its diverse product portfolio. Beyond basmati rice, they also offer a selection of spices and chakki fresh atta (whole wheat flour). Further diversifying their offerings, they have introduced a ready-to-cook biryani kit, tapping into the growing demand for convenient meal solutions. This diversification strategy allows them to reach a broader consumer base and mitigate risk associated with reliance on a single product.
The company's branding strategy is multifaceted, utilizing several distinct brand names to target different market segments and price points. Their brand portfolio includes 10X, 7 Express, Tanoush, Shakti, and Himalaya, each potentially appealing to specific consumer preferences and purchasing power. This approach allows for effective market penetration and brand recognition across various demographics.
GRM Overseas' reach extends beyond the Indian domestic market. They are active exporters, shipping their products to several international destinations. The Middle East, the United Kingdom, and the United States are among their key export markets, indicating a significant international presence and a commitment to global expansion. This international reach underscores the company's scale and success in competing on a global stage.
